Offline mode in the Trailmark field-survey client queues submissions in a local store and replays them when connectivity returns. The reviewer should verify that each queued record carries a client-generated idempotency token, since the Basinfetch sync service deduplicates on that field alone. Conflicts are resolved last-write-wins at the record level, not per field. Replay requests authenticate against Basinfetch directly rather than the public gateway, using the internal service key below.

gateway credential: kto3_c9i

### Ticket: Thumbwheel vault locked, queue backing up

Flagging for the weekly sync: the Thumbwheel thumbnail generation queue has been stalled since Tuesday because the credentials vault auto-locked after a failed rotation. Workers can't fetch render keys, so ~40k thumbnails are pending. Retry logic is fine; we just need the vault reopened before the backlog spills into the weekend. To unseal it, use the recovery passphrase noted below.

unlock words, hahip-baduf: holwyn-istath-julvan

Runbook: Brightaisle barcode scanner bridge

Before touching the Brightaisle scanner bridge, confirm the device firmware version matches the compatibility matrix — mismatches cause silent checksum failures that look like network issues. Always drain the event queue before redeploying, and record each step you take in the shift log. The firmware matrix and drain procedure are on the internal page below.

dashboard of bafof-hafog = https://confluence.lumiclabs.internal/display/browse/display/6a09a20a

Do not round intermediate values — sum in full precision, round once at the end. Known issue: the legacy v1 endpoint truncates instead of rounding half-even, producing off-by-one-cent totals on large batches. Migrate to v2 before the v1 sunset next quarter. Ostermere will not credit discrepancies caused by client-side rounding. Report confirmed conversion defects, with request payloads attached, to their integration desk.

escalation mailbox, bafog-fafog: ulador@paliqlabs.internal